structure of 3-Bromo-4-chloro-1H-pyrrolo[2,3-b]pyridine

3-Bromo-4-chloro-1H-pyrrolo[2,3-b]pyridine

CAS No.: 1000340-39-5
M. Wt: 231.477
M. Fa: C7H4BrClN2
InChI Key: QLGXTRWCWHBPDP-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Appearance: Yellow Solid

Applications of 1000340-39-5

3-Bromo-4-chloro-1H-pyrrolo[2,3-b]pyridine has several applications:

  • Pharmaceutical Development: Its potential anticancer and antimicrobial properties make it a candidate for drug development.
  • Research Tool: This compound is used in various biochemical assays to study its effects on biological systems.
  • Material Science: Due to its unique chemical properties, it may find applications in developing new materials or as a building block for organic electronics.

The ongoing research into its properties could lead to new applications across various fields.
